There’s a ton of development happening and planned for Chattanooga but when we look back at recent openings, we see a lot of food + drink, and you can bet we’re excited about it.

Outside of the “Um, where are we going to eat” category, the past few months did bring a new business, New Bloom Labs, from Chattanooga businessman John Kerns, whose startup is offering compliance and quality control testing to the exploding hemp industry.

And Viget, a company that brands, designs + builds software products for startups and big corporations, opened an office here.

Big-Kahuna Wings
This eatery specializes in hormone-free, organic, dry-rub wings. It’s just across the street from the Tennessee Aquarium + riverfront.

Ruby Sunshine
The Market Street eatery which features brunch menus + New Orleans fare has been packed in recent weekends.

Jussa 2 Chics
Lisa David + Anna Williams opened this juice + smoothie delivery business to share their passion for plant-based foods. They also have a cookbook.
